cage fab

some pics of the start of the cage , I am building it out of 1 1/2 dom . I hope it turns out good , Its difficult to clear the hand crank for the windows and the e brake and not have a knee killer . yes kgb I did take the seats out of the blue truck , its on the back burner . I will probably weld the cage to the rock sliders that are bolted to the frame .
